Job Summary
Develop and execute integrated marketing campaigns across radio, digital platforms, podcasts, streaming channels, and mobile applications to drive audience growth and engagement. Lead strategic initiatives that support Moody Radio, ministry programs, fundraising efforts, and events while managing budgets and performance metrics. Collaborate with internal teams and external partners to deliver on-time, on-budget results aligned with organizational goals. Track campaign performance, analyze data to optimize user engagement, and continuously improve marketing processes. Occasional evening and weekend responsibilities; approximately 10% travel required.
